Clash of Two Religions: Erosion of Indigenous System by Pentecostalism in the Shona People, Zimbabwe
This desk analysis exposes conflicts that have been created by the coming of Christianity and how they may be resolved from an endogenous perspective within the Shona people in Zimbabwe.
